    GREY GOOSE unveils new ready-to-drink flavoured version

    Grey Gosse, the vodka most recommended by bartenders and the leader in the super-premium category, is proud to introduce GREY GOOSE Essences, made with GREY GOOSE Vodka infused with real fruit essences and cold-distilled botanicals.

    As the brand’s most expansive innovation to date, the range is crafted with natural flavours and was meticulously developed with the highest-quality craftsmanship and attention to detail that have become synonymous with GREY GOOSE. Following the successful launch in the US, the range will make its debut in the UK this April. Available in three fresh and distinct flavours, GREY GOOSE Essences are not simply tasted, but experienced. GREY GOOSE Essences Vodka spritz, ready to drink versions will also be launching in June – historically becoming the first ready to drink range released for the brand.

    With increasing demand for fresh tasting flavours and natural ingredients, GREY GOOSE Essences is born out of a heightened desire for simple cocktails that are brimming with vibrant flavour. Designed for those who sip mindfully, each Essences expression offers an ABV of 30%, 82 calories per 50ml, and contains no artificial ingredients.

    The Ready to Drink version is carefully crafted with GREY GOOSE Vodka, sparkling water, a touch of juice, and natural flavours. They are 4.5% ABV, and 250ml cans are 79 calories.  Like all GREY GOOSE products, Essences is gluten-free and made without compromise, fusing a light, smooth taste with an immersive fruit and botanical flavour palate. The trio of expressions include the bright and citrusy Strawberry & Lemongrass, the floral, yet savoury White Peach & Rosemary, and the fresh-tasting and peppery Watermelon & Basil.

    The flavours in each Essences expression are derived from some of the freshest fruits and highest quality botanicals from around the world—in locations such as France, Spain, Thailand, and Sri Lanka—all carefully selected by GREY GOOSE Cellar Master François Thibault. These fruits are picked at the peak of their ripeness and blended with the cold distilled botanicals and GREY GOOSE Vodka. Each batch is created using the same soft winter wheat from Picardie and water from a dedicated well in Gensac-La-Pallue that gives GREY GOOSE its signature smooth taste.

    Essences will be available from April with a RRP of £39 for a 700ml bottle. The full range can be purchased nation-wide at Waitrose, Tesco, Majestic Wine Costco and other leading retailers this Spring along with select on-trade accounts. RTD versions will be available from June 2022.
